What Do Managed IT Services Actually Cost in West Virginia? Most West Virginia businesses with 10 to 50 employees pay between $100 and $200 per user each month for a full managed services package. That figure covers monitoring, help desk support, patching, and baseline security. Managed IT services West Virginia pricing depends on device count and whether compliance work is involved.
